About the book >.>.> My own beginning with the academic study of religion goes back to my sophomore year in college. I still hadn’t decided on a major and one night ducked into a lecture by Frederick Jameson. At the time I had no idea that Jameson was a prominent intellectual and the content of his talk though compelling was a bit over my head. But the question/answer period generated a turning point for me. One of my friends bravely stood up and asked a question which went something like this: “Prof. Jameson you seem to be saying that even artists who are really avant garde are still just sell-outs. So my question is if totally crazy creative people can’t change anything then what about the rest of us? What are we supposed to do if we want to change the world we live in?” Jameson paused for a moment and said “Know everything.” And that’s pretty much where he left his answer. Since then I have learned how to fit that answer into the broader context of Jameson’s thought (“Always historicize” for those in the know) but when I heard it this response struck me: it posed a challenge that only a young person could take literally. That semester I was taking my first classes in religion and something clicked. Religion seemed to be everywhere making its way into every facet of human history so maybe studying it was the best way to “know everything.” Soon after Jameson’s lecture I decided to become a religious-studies major. You will be happy to know that I have gotten over the hubris inspired by Jameson’s maxim Bur my teachers in religious studies have consistently reinforced the spirit of that early insight. The study of religion spans the breadth of human experience. (SP)
